    Jason Mraz – ‘We Sing. We Dance. We Steal Things’ charts at No. 8 »

    Jason Mraz

    Jason Mraz’s album ‘We Sing. We Dance. We Steal Things’ has stolen a march on the Top Ten and charted at No. 8 this week. Released on January 5th the album has been propelled by the success of hit single “I’m Yours” and has been a main-stayer all over the radio …

    A Thousand Suns ‘Destroy Create’ review »

    A Thousand Suns

    A Thousand Suns is an up and coming band from South Wales, set to release their debut EP, ‘Destroy Create’. The three founding members Dan Greenall, Tom Latham and Joe Latham formed the band in 2006 (with the later addition of Super G on bass), and in the past year have played all over South Wales … Read the review!
